I am going to be living in an apartment on Ocean Ave right by where it intersects with Parkside Ave. I haven't spent much time around this area and wanted to know if anyone had any thoughts. It seems like the park is right next door and it's one block away from the Q which is great. Any advice or opinions would be much appreciated. Thanks....

Used to be a pretty bad area but it's improved greatly, I still would use some caution at night time in the area however. A person used to living in a high-crime or above average crime area would feel absolutely feel comfortable living there. It's kinda like the West Indian version of Washington Heights, but with a little less overall crime.

The park will be nice. Dining/nightlife/bar scene is limited. Q can be a pain, and be ready to take cabs from Atlantic Ave if you tend to go out late. Get a bike to make trips to somewhat nearby neighborhoods like Prospect Heights, Park Slope, etc. quicker and easier.
